N2 - The changing stature of the environment and society, in general, necessitates a shift from the business-as-usual approaches to sustainable frameworks in the water industry. The industry’s reliance on conventional methods has created gaps in service delivery and the attainment of Sustainable Development Goals. Sustainable approaches have been implemented but are yet to reap any benefits for the foreseeable future. The flailing nature of the industry has created a need for the integration of sustainable initiatives such as the circular economy and Industry 4.0 technologies. A systematic review was conducted to determine the implementation and integration of sustainability in the water industry. The examination utilized the PRISMA framework to identify the best fit articles for inclusion. A total of 48 articles were identified that explored both the concepts of implementation and integration. The findings indicate that the circular economy initiatives will close the loops through the 6R model. Furthermore, the application of Industry 4.0 technologies such as artificial intelligence, IoT, and big data will increase the efficiency/performance of the industry. The paper has a favorable implication for society and the industry, as it recommends specific tools/interventions for sustainable water management.
